We experimentally obtained a three-dimensional (3D) isotope-selective CT image based on a NRF transmission method (3D NRF-CT) for the enriched lead isotope distribution of 208Pb in a previous study. Since the NRF-CT imaging technique requires a considerable data accumulation time, it took 48 h to obtain an image with a resolution of 4 mm/pixel in the horizontal plane and 8 mm/pixel in the vertical plane for a cylindrical sample with a diameter of 25 mm and a height of 20 mm using a laser Compton scattering (LCS) gamma-ray beam with a beam size of 2 mm and a flux density of 10 photons/s/eV. Improving the NRF-CT image resolution with the existing hardware is challenging. Therefore, we proposed an alternative method to improve the NRF-CT image quality using the fusion visualization (FV) technique by combining the NRF-CT image including isotopic information with a gamma-CT image, which provides better pixel resolution. The 3D gamma-CT image for the same sample was measured at the same beamline BL1U in the UVSOR-III synchrotron radiation facility under similar experimental conditions except for the LCS gamma-ray beam flux and beam size. Obtaining a 3D gamma-CT image with a resolution of 1 mm/pixel took 5 h using an LCS gamma-ray beam with a beam size of 1 mm and a flux density of 0.7 photons/s/eV. The data processing of the FV technique has been developed, and the 3D NRF-CT image quality was im-proved.","subitem_description_type":"Abstract"}]},"item_8_publisher_8":{"attribute_name":"出版者","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_publisher":"MDPI"}]},"item_8_relation_14":{"attribute_name":"DOI","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_relation_type_id":{"subitem_relation_type_id_text":"10.3390/app112411866","subitem_relation_type_select":"DOI"}}]},"item_8_relation_17":{"attribute_name":"関連サイト","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_relation_type_id":{"subitem_relation_type_id_text":"https://www.mdpi.com/2076-3417/11/24/11866","subitem_relation_type_select":"URI"}}]},"item_8_source_id_9":{"attribute_name":"ISSN","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_source_identifier":"2076-3417","subitem_source_identifier_type":"ISSN"}]},"item_access_right":{"attribute_name":"アクセス権","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_access_right":"metadata only access","subitem_access_right_uri":"http://purl.org/coar/access_right/c_14cb"}]},"item_creator":{"attribute_name":"著者","attribute_type":"creator","attribute_value_mlt":[{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Ali, Khaled"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040922","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Zen, Heishun"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040923","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Ohgaki , Hideaki"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040924","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Kii, Toshiteru"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040925","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Hayakawa, Takehito"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040926","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Shizuma, Toshiyuki"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040927","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Katoh, Masahiro"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040928","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Taira, Yoshitaka"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040929","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Fujimoto, Masaki"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040930","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Toyokawa, Hiroyuki"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040931","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Takehito, Hayakawa","creatorNameLang":"en"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040932","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]},{"creatorNames":[{"creatorName":"Toshiyuki, Shizuma","creatorNameLang":"en"}],"nameIdentifiers":[{"nameIdentifier":"1040933","nameIdentifierScheme":"WEKO"}]}]},"item_language":{"attribute_name":"言語","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_language":"eng"}]},"item_resource_type":{"attribute_name":"資源タイプ","attribute_value_mlt":[{"resourcetype":"journal article","resourceuri":"http://purl.org/coar/resource_type/c_6501"}]},"item_title":"Fusion Visualization Technique to Improve a Three-Dimensional Isotope-Selective CT Image Based on Nuclear Resonance Fluo-rescence with a Gamma-CT Image","item_titles":{"attribute_name":"タイトル","attribute_value_mlt":[{"subitem_title":"Fusion Visualization Technique to Improve a Three-Dimensional Isotope-Selective CT Image Based on Nuclear Resonance Fluo-rescence with a Gamma-CT Image"}]},"item_type_id":"8","owner":"1","path":["1"],"pubdate":{"attribute_name":"公開日","attribute_value":"2021-11-25"},"publish_date":"2021-11-25","publish_status":"0","recid":"84906","relation_version_is_last":true,"title":["Fusion Visualization Technique to Improve a Three-Dimensional Isotope-Selective CT Image Based on Nuclear Resonance Fluo-rescence with a Gamma-CT Image"],"weko_creator_id":"1","weko_shared_id":-1},"updated":"2023-05-15T17:24:18.033633+00:00"}
